Abstract

The excited resonant states (RS) of the shallow donors degenerate with the spectrum of free carriers are studied by means of FIR laser magnetospectroscopy. A contactless photoelectrical detection technique and super-pure germanium samples have been used (N D - N A = 10 11 cm −3). The magnetic field dependence of the RS energy spectrum has been investigated. The RS have identified by means of the selection rules for dipole electrical transitions.
